The provisions of the Insolvency & Bankruptcy Code, 2016 envisage resolution of insolvency of aCorporate entity facing financial crunch by triggering Corporate Insolvency Resolution Process in a time bound manner through formulation of Resolution Plan or in the alternate, Liquidation if Resolution of debts is not possible.
The provisions of the Insolvency & Bankruptcy Code, 2016 has been amended from time to time to deal with various issues arising during implementation. Recently, the Government has also notified the Personal Insolvency Provisions of the Code.
Under the provisions of the Insolvency Code, the NCLT is the Adjudicating Authority and the NCLAT is the First Appellate Tribunal for the Corporate Debtor. Any further Appeal from the Judgment and Orders of NCLAT lies before the Hon’ble Supreme Court of India.
The proceedings for Personal Insolvency are filed before NCLT if the Personal Debtor is a Guarantor for a Company undergoing Corporate Insolvency proceedings before the NCLT. In other cases, Personal Insolvency will be handled by jurisdictional DRT.
